What is recorded here

Near the top of a N-facing slope in pasture. Hachured as a rath on the 1840 OS 6-inch map with another (CL025-194002-) immediately adjacent at NE. Also hachured on the 1920 Cassini edition. Listed as ‘Enclosure, possible’ in the SMR (1992) and the RMP (1996). On inspection in 1999 there were no visible traces at ground level. The area had been cleared and the soil pushed N to the present field boundary. No visible traces on available aerial imagery (2024). Compiled by: Mary Tunney   Date of upload: 1 December 2025
